开发者常见的三大调试困境

场景一:报错信息看不懂,Google也找不到答案

某跨境电商CTO曾耗时3天解决一个SSL证书报错,直到用Rubber Duck AI复述问题时突然发现配置遗漏。2024年StackOverflow调研显示,42%的技术问题因提问方式不当导致无人解答。

解决方案:
1. 访问Rubber Duck AI官网,点击"开始对话"
2. 将报错信息逐字粘贴并加上"请用外行能懂的语言解释这个错误"

场景二:代码能运行但存在逻辑漏洞

FinTech公司SafePay的审计代码曾漏掉关键边界条件,直到工程师用Rubber Duck AI模拟攻击者视角提问。MIT 2023年研究表明,口头解释代码能发现85%的潜在漏洞。

解决方案:
1. 在AI对话框中输入"假设你是黑客,请找出这段代码的5种攻击方式:"
2. 对照OWASP Top 10检查反馈结果

场景三:新框架学习效率低下

教育科技创业者林晨用传统教程学习React Native耗时2周,改用Rubber Duck AI的"苏格拉底式提问法"后3天完成项目原型。2024年GitHub调查显示,交互式学习效率比文档阅读高217%。

解决方案:
1. 输入"我不知道如何开始用Next.js,请分步骤提问引导我"
2. 根据AI的引导性问题逐步构建知识体系

4条提升调试效率的建议

1. 每日记录:用AI生成调试日志(可节省47%重复问题处理时间)
2. 预设问题库:建立常见错误的AI提问模板
3. 团队共享:创建团队知识库标签(参考社媒获客工具的协作功能)
4. 定期复盘:用AI分析错误模式趋势

FAQ

Q:Rubber Duck AI与传统调试工具有何不同?
A:它通过强制结构化表达激活元认知,2024年IEEE实验证明其问题发现率比断点调试高39%

Q:是否适合非技术场景?
A:当然!某法律团队用它梳理案件逻辑,文书准备时间缩短62%(见IP检测服务的客户案例)

总结

就像小李最终发现那个愚蠢的拼写错误一样,Rubber Duck AI能帮你跳出思维盲区。下次遇到难题时,不妨先对AI"鸭子"说清楚问题本身。